Explanation
Pressure equals weight divided by contact area Steps:
- Weight of cube W = mass m × g, where g is acceleration due to free fall.
- Mass m = density ρ × volume V, and for cube V = s³ with side length s.
- Contact area A = s² (face area).
- Pressure P = W / A = (ρ × s³ × g) / s² = ρ × g × s.
Why C is correct:
- Pressure on the base equals ρ g h from hydrostatics, where h = s (side length) is the height of the cube.
